Les Potiers d’ Acccolay French Midcentury Ceramic Vase

About the Item

Hand thrown ceramic French midcentury vase from Les Potiers d’Accolay with an almost organic form. Beautiful glazed with richly colored speckled glaze. Measures: Height 10.75”, width 6”, depth 5.5”.
